Produktbeschreibung
The genus Selenomonas constitutes a group of motile crescent-shaped bacteria within the Veillonellaceae family and include species living in the gastrointestinal tracts of animals, in particular, the Ruminants. A few of the smaller forms discovered with the light microscope are now in culture but many are not because of their fastidious and incompletely known requirements. The family Veillonellaceae was transferred from the order Clostridiales to the new order Selenomonadales in the new class Negativicutes. Despite most of the members of the Firmicutes staining positive for the Gram stain and being trivially called "low-GC Gram-positives" (c.f. Bacterial phyla),members of the Negativicutes stain Gram-negative and possess a double bilayer.
